Specifying fill opacity


    In addition to setting opacity for a layer, which affects any layer styles and blending modes applied to the layer, you can specify a fill opacity for layers. Fill opacity affects pixels painted in a layer or shapes drawn on a layer without affecting the opacity of any layer effects that have been applied to the layer.

To specify fill opacity for a layer:

    Do one of the following:

    • (Photoshop) In the Layers palette, enter a value in the Fill Opacity text box or drag the Fill Opacity pop-up slider.
    • (Photoshop) Double-click a layer thumbnail, choose Layer > Layer Style > Blending Options, or choose Add a Layer Style > Blending Options from the Layers palette menu. Enter a value in the Fill Opacity text box.

    Note: To view blending options for a text layer, choose Layer > Layer Style > Blending Options, or choose Blending Options from the Add a Layer Style button at the bottom of the Layers palette menu. (ImageReady) Choose Layer > Layer Style > Blending Options and enter a value in the Fill Opacity text box.
